Is selling Genshin merch illegal?
Along the same lines, the use of official materials (whether retouched or not) in the production of merchandise is explicitly forbidden, as is the sale of merchandise claiming to be official, and consequently the falsification of official merchandise.Is it legal to sell fanmade merch?
For fan merchandising, obtaining explicit copyright permission is vital before selling goods featuring trademarked names, logos, or characters. Even if your fan designs are legally transformative, commercialization rights still apply and often require licensing.Is Genshin copyright free?
No. miHoYo has full intellectual property rights, copyright, trade secrets and other related rights and interests to the Genshin Impact project, including but not limited to game content.Can you sell Genshin merch on Etsy?
Fans must also clearly state the words “fan-made merchandise” on wherever it's being sold. The changes allow more Genshin Impact fans to sell their own custom-made merchandise through sites like Etsy or Redbubble, as well as places like physical stores and conventions.Are you allowed to sell Genshin Impact account?

But, sadly, this doesn't stop people from printing and selling t-shirts with copyrighted material, especially when the most that an artist can do is send a DMCA notice.What happens if you get a copyright infringement notice on Etsy?
Etsy's Intellectual Property Policy requires us to remove or disable content from Etsy shops if we receive a report of alleged intellectual property infringement. If any of your listings are removed due to an infringement claim, you'll receive an email with the contact information of the party who filed it.
